Belleving in the waters of heal- ing advocated by a new religion more than 1,000 men and women were immersed in lukewarm water in a moss-lined tank in the presence of a large London audi- ence in the Albert Hall,
this new sect-the Elim Evangel The dominating personality in of the Four Square Gospel-Is Principal George Jeffreys, a young Welshman, who, together with half a dozen Belfast shop-assist- ants, founded the sect of the "Elimites" In Monaghan, North- ern Ireland, 12 years ago.
His preaching style is modelled on the typical Salvation Army cap- tain. It is claimed that he has 6,000 followers in London alone.

effect of giving two votes to a cer- One of the clauses will have the tain number of women. These are the wives of men having, a voting qualification both in respect of re- sidence and of business premises. Husbands of women with similar voting qualifications will also have two votes.
